How Do I Resize Icons on Android?

Android phones come with default icon sizes, but you easily change the size of icons. If you have a newer Android phone, then resizing icons is a quick Settings adjustment.

Swipe down on the home screen and tap the gear icon at the upper right to enter your Android’s Settings menu. Scroll down and select Display to open the Display Settings menu. Select Advanced to expand that section. In the Advanced Display settings menu, select Display size. On the Display Size window, move the slider at the bottom to adjust the size of screen items. You’ll see a sample of what text and icons will look like in the top part of the window. Now, when you return to the Home screen, you’ll notice that the icons on the screen are larger, based on where you adjusted the size setting.

If you want to resize icons or make your app icons smaller, follow the same procedure above but adjust the screen item size to smaller (to the left) rather than larger.

How Do I Reduce the Size of the Icons on My Samsung Phone?

If you have a Samsung phone, resizing icons on the screen is even easier.

Go to the Home screen and long-press anywhere in the blank area. You’ll see menu icons appear at the bottom of the screen. Select the Settings icon on the lower right. In the Home screen settings window, there are two options to adjust icon sizes. First, select Home screen grid. On the Home screen grid page, use the icons along the bottom to adjust how many icons you want to appear on each Home page screen. The more icons you allow, the smaller those icons will be. Select Save when you’re done. The preview window at the top of this screen will show you how large or small the icons appear based on the grid setting you’ve selected. Back on the Home screen settings window, select Apps screen grid to adjust the size of the icons on the Apps screen windows. Adjust the icon sizes in the same way, using the grid selection along the bottom of the window. Select Save when you’re done.

The icons on the Home screen and the Apps screen will appear the size you selected using the grid settings when you’re done.

Resize Icon With Third-Party Apps

If you don’t have a newer Android or own a Samsung phone, you can install Android launchers that let you resize icons on your Android.

The following are some Android launcher apps that let you do this.

Nova Launcher: Provides the closest UI environment to stock Android. It’s a lightweight and fast launcher that lets you set a custom grid size similar to how Samsung users can resize app icons. Microsoft Launcher: Instead of using the grid approach, this launcher actually lets you adjust the layout and size of icons on the Home and App screen. It includes a list of useful customization options beyond just icon size. Apex Launcher: In this launcher’s settings menu, you’ll find the ability to adjust icon sizes from 50% up to 150% the normal icon size. Go Launcher: With GO Launcher installed, just long-press the Home screen, choose Settings and use the Icon settings to adjust icons to Big, Default size, or Custom size.
